Most likely impact will be at WR. Keep your eye on Joseph Ferguson. He isn't a RS frosh, he is a transfer from NW, and was recruited by a handful of big 10 schools was pretty well reguarded. Sanders is also highly regarded and reportedly looks great in practice.
The other interesting RS to watch would be Enright and Allison on the OL. I think we are moving to a point in the program where you shouldn't compete on the OL until you are a sophomore, but both those guys were pretty highly regarded coming out of HS.
CB could be interesting as well, where Lindley, Settle, and Haynes will all compete for a spot. Settle is really athletic, Lindley has the size, and Haynes has the speed.
I don't think we will see anyone new at QB, RB, DL, LB, or saftey. If we do, it means JUCOs didn't come through (QB, LB, Saftey) or we have a lot of injuries and we are in trouble.
